I think on reflection one of my biggest frustrations, amongst many… other than not creating anything in an attacking sense with an urgency is the recurring pass we play into midfield after having the ball at the back.. we continually have the ball at the back and are being pressured (great, it’s creating space) but it’s near our goal… then the ball is passed under pressure into the midfield and it’s never to an obvious player just into space - then a midfielder will be running at pace towards our goal to receive a ball that’s slowing down but he’s closely tracked by a opponent who is also running at pace - but facing our goal. Our player can’t turn so he can only flick the ball left or right or pass back - it’s this next ball that is continually given away - and the press is all facing our goal, all running that way and our defenders are spread out and on the back foot from being pressed in the prior part of the move. it happens every game, and it’s so often leads to opposition chances - I think the triggers have been sussed cos martin “won’t change” - so what hope is there? very very symptomatic of what’s wrong at the moment.
